    Quote Originally Posted by Whopper View Post
    Thanks for the input....the reason I was thinking 4 stroke is b.c I want to troll some, and I think I can dial a 4 stroke down slow enough to get to speed, and not have to deal with a kicker and custom rigging to mount the kicker.
    I do not believe you would see any difference in your idle trolling speed. 2 stroke/4 stroke. They both idle around the same RPM. Also, 4 strokes at idle have the lowest oil pressure the engine has/sees and as bearings etc wear you have lower oil pressure. Those are the worst conditions for long periods. The 2 strokes have oil suspended in their roller bearings ( they do not have/use regular style 4 stroke bearings) and do not have any oil pressure to speak of.
